Con Paul Walker, Tyrese Gibson, Eva Mendes, Cole Hauser, Ludacris, Michael Ealy, Devon Aoki, Amaury Nolasco
L'ex poliziotto Brian O'Conner accetta di aiutare il suo vecchio partner Roman Pierce a trasportare una partita di denaro sporco per conto del boss malavitoso Carter Verone, che come attività di copertura gestisce una ditta di import-export in Florida. In realtà, in questo modo, Brian prosegue il proprio lavoro di copertura accanto all'agente Monica Fuentes, che si è infiltrata nell'organizzazione per tentare di smantellarla...
